>That happened to me once as well. If I can remember, I trashed the
>invisible file MacTCP DNS in the System folder and also the TCP/IP
You mean MacTCP DNR? :) Yeah, get rid of that. Get rid of it every time
you shut down. It doesn't actually do anything except get itself
corrupted. Mac OS 9 makes it obsolete.
